1) IrDA devices have built-in error checking; remote controls usually do not have this feature. 2) Remote controls work at greater distances. 3) Remote controls are unidirectional, but IrDA devices are bidirectional.
IR (infrared) remote controls are considered line of sight, meaning the remote has to "see" the device it is controlling. An RF remote is not because the signal has the strength to pass through some objects.

Infrared light is used in remote controls to transmit signals to electronic devices by converting electrical signals into infrared light pulses. These pulses are then sent from the remote control to a receiver on the electronic device, which decodes the pulses and carries out the corresponding command, such as changing the channel on a TV or adjusting the volume on a stereo.
